In today’s fast-paced and competitive business world, effective leadership is crucial for the success of any organization. However, leadership skills do not always come naturally to everyone. This is where coaching comes in as a valuable tool for developing leadership abilities.
coaching and leadership are closely intertwined concepts that work hand in hand to drive individual and organizational growth. While leadership focuses on setting direction, aligning resources, and inspiring others to achieve a common goal, coaching is all about helping individuals maximize their potential, overcome obstacles, and achieve personal and professional success.
Many successful leaders credit coaching as a key factor in their development and growth. By working with a coach, leaders can identify their strengths and weaknesses, set clear goals, and create actionable plans to enhance their leadership skills. A coach provides valuable feedback, support, and guidance to help leaders navigate challenges, make sound decisions, and achieve outstanding results.
One of the most significant benefits of coaching is its ability to foster self-awareness in leaders. Self-awareness is the foundation of effective leadership because it enables leaders to understand their strengths and limitations, manage their emotions, and build strong relationships with others. Through coaching, leaders can gain valuable insights into their behaviors, beliefs, and values, which empowers them to make positive changes and improve their leadership effectiveness.
Coaching also plays a crucial role in developing key leadership competencies such as communication, emotional intelligence, and conflict resolution. A coach can provide leaders with practical tools and strategies to enhance their communication skills, build rapport with team members, and resolve conflicts in a constructive and timely manner. By leveraging coaching, leaders can become more empathetic, influential, and adaptable in their leadership approach.
Furthermore, coaching helps leaders tap into their full potential by challenging their limiting beliefs, mindset, and behaviors. A coach can help leaders break through self-imposed barriers, develop a growth mindset, and cultivate a positive attitude towards change and innovation. Through coaching, leaders can unlock their innate talents, creativity, and resilience, which enables them to lead with confidence, courage, and authenticity.
